What is Mehndi?

Mehndi is a form of body art that involves applying a paste made from the leaves of the henna plant to the skin. This paste dyes the skin a reddish-brown color, creating intricate designs that can last for up to two weeks. Mehndi is most commonly used in South Asian weddings and celebrations, where it is applied to the hands and feet of the bride and other female guests. However, it is also becoming more popular as a form of everyday body art.

The Significance of Mehndi

In South Asian cultures, mehndi is a symbol of good luck, happiness, and prosperity. It is believed that the darker the mehndi stain on the skin, the stronger the love between the bride and groom. Mehndi is also thought to have cooling properties, which can be beneficial in hot climates. In addition, mehndi designs often incorporate traditional symbols and motifs, such as peacocks, paisleys, and flowers, which hold cultural significance.

Mehndi Designs for Hand Back

When it comes to mehndi designs for hand backs, the options are endless. From simple, minimalist designs to intricate, full-hand patterns, there is a mehndi design to suit every taste and style. Some popular designs include:

1. Floral Mehndi

Floral mehndi designs are a classic choice, and they never go out of style. These designs often feature delicate flowers, leaves, and vines, and they can be as simple or intricate as you like. Floral mehndi is a great choice for those who want a feminine and romantic look.

2. Arabic Mehndi

Arabic mehndi designs are known for their bold, geometric patterns and thick outlines. These designs often feature abstract shapes, such as triangles, squares, and diamonds, and they can be applied to the entire hand or just the fingers. Arabic mehndi is a great choice for those who want a bold and dramatic look.

3. Peacock Mehndi

Peacock mehndi designs are a popular choice, particularly for weddings and other formal events. These designs often feature intricate peacock feathers, which symbolize beauty and elegance. Peacock mehndi is a great choice for those who want a sophisticated and glamorous look.

4. Minimalist Mehndi

For those who prefer a more understated look, minimalist mehndi designs are a great choice. These designs often feature simple, geometric patterns, such as dots, triangles, and lines. Minimalist mehndi is a great choice for those who want a subtle yet stylish look.

5. Mandala Mehndi

Mandala mehndi designs are inspired by traditional Indian mandalas, which are circular designs that represent the universe. These designs often feature intricate patterns and symbols, and they can be applied to the entire hand or just the palm. Mandala mehndi is a great choice for those who want a spiritual and meaningful look.

How to Care for Your Mehndi Design

To ensure that your mehndi design lasts as long as possible, it's important to take good care of it. Here are some tips for caring for your mehndi design: - Leave the mehndi paste on your skin for at least 6-8 hours before washing it off. - Avoid getting your mehndi design wet for the first 24 hours after application. - Apply a mixture of lemon juice and sugar to your mehndi design once it has dried to help enhance the color. - Avoid using soap or other harsh chemicals on the area where your mehndi design is located. - Apply a moisturizing lotion to the area regularly to help keep the skin hydrated.

5 Unique FAQs About Mehndi Designs for Hand Back

1. Is mehndi safe for all skin types?

Mehndi is generally safe for all skin types, but it's important to do a patch test before applying it to a large area. Some people may experience an allergic reaction to the henna paste, which can cause itching, redness, and swelling.

2. How long does a mehndi design last?

A mehndi design can last for up to two weeks, depending on factors such as the quality of the henna paste, the location of the design, and how well it is cared for.

3. Can I apply mehndi myself?

While it's possible to apply mehndi yourself using a store-bought kit, it can be tricky if you're not experienced. It's best to have a professional apply the mehndi for you, especially if you want a more intricate design.

4. How do I remove a mehndi design?

To remove a mehndi design, simply wait for it to fade naturally over time. You can also try soaking the area in warm water and gently scrubbing it with a loofah to help speed up the process.

5. Can I swim with a mehndi design?

It's best to avoid swimming or getting your mehndi design wet for the first 24 hours after application. After that, you can swim as usual, but be aware that exposure to chlorine and other chemicals can cause the mehndi design to fade more quickly.
